I vaguely recall that there was a short-lived Officers Confidential Reporting system between the F1369 and OJAR. F6500 (?) or similar I think. Anyway, Spectre 150 was working in a busy staff job for a 1RO who was destined for, and achieved, VSO status. The new reporting system was based on a new numbering system which the 1RO rigorously applied - unfortunately not in my favour. The list of low numbers looked very stark but I had little time to suck my teeth and protest as the 1RO was posted and walking out of the door on a Friday afternoon. But I had faith in the system, the 2RO was there to provide an element of 'checks and balances' and all would be well in the end.

When the 2RO read from his narrative that Spectre 150 'lacked the intellectual rigour to mark him out from his peers' I knew I was doomed. What came as a bigger surprise, and a most welcome one, was when the 3RO Air Officer called me in - he was a fearsome man with a reputation to match - instead of cutting me off at the knees and throwing me out of the HQ as I expected, after asking what I thought of my annual assessment, proceeded to metaphorically tear it up and threw me a lifeline in the form of a 6 month deferral and a new report from my new incoming 1RO.

This was all in the days of open reporting - wonder how it would have panned out in the old closed book system.
